By Gyang Bere, Jos A former member of the House of Representatives in the Eighth National Assembly, Dr. Suleiman Yahaya-Kwande, recently constructed and furnished a 14-bed clinic for residents of Jos North Local Government Area of Plateau State. It was learnt that the clinic, located in the centre of Jos, would serve the health needs of the less privileged in society. The Yahaya Kwande Community Clinic has female and male wards, children and delivery units and a consulting room for doctors and nurses where emergency cases would be attended to. Dr. Suleiman commenced the construction of the clinic as part of his constituency projects during the Eighth Assembly but couldn’t finish it before he left the House of Representatives in 2019. He completed, furnished and handed over the facility to the community on Monday, August 24.
